Seaway7 is a global leader in the delivery of fixed offshore wind farm projects, supporting developers to bring sustainable, renewable energy to the world through the construction of fixed offshore wind farms.

We are a global company headquartered in Oslo - Norway with five further main offices in Aberdeen – UK, Leer – Germany, Vejle - Denmark, Taipei - Taiwan and Zoetermeer - the Netherlands, and furthermore a local presence in all key offshore wind regions around the world. We employ more than 500 people onshore, and an offshore workforce of around 400.

With more than 10 years of offshore wind experience, a state-of-the art fleet, specialist technologies and a range of integrated contracting models, we are well positioned to seize the opportunities of this rapidly growing market. What is the role?

To act as package manager or project manager focused on mission equipment design and construction on our existing or new ships.  We are lifting and shifting weights up to 5000 t and hammering with 4 megajoule impact.  You will be coordinating directly with suppliers or internally with other discipline engineers, supply chain management, QC, planning or document control. We are developing our ships and equipment from concept through to EPC with the help of the best suppliers in the market.
